Determining the robustness of a material is crucial in various industries. One common method for evaluating click here this feature is through tensile testing, which measures the load required to elongate a material until it breaks. To perform these tests accurately and precisely, specialized machines called tensile testers are employed.

Tensile testers typically consist of a rigidity that holds two clamps, one fixed and the other movable. A specimen, usually in the form of a strip, is placed between these clamps. The movable clamp is then applied with increasing force. Throughout this process, the machine records the applied force and the corresponding elongation of the specimen.

  • Key parameters derived from tensile testing include ultimate tensile strength (UTS), yield strength, and elongation at break.
  • These values provide valuable insights into the material's behavior under stretching loads.

Different types of tensile testers are available to accommodate various material sizes and testing requirements. Certain machines are designed for extreme force applications, while others are tailored for specific materials like plastics or textiles.

Tensile Test Machine Applications in Materials Science

Tensile test machines play a crucial role in the field of materials science for characterizing the mechanical properties of various substances. These machines apply a controlled tensile load to a specimen, measuring its response in terms of stress and strain. The obtained data furnishes invaluable insights into the material's strength, ductility, elasticity, and fracture behavior. Tensile testing is indispensable for evaluating the suitability of materials for specific applications, such as engineering, where mechanical performance is paramount.

  • Moreover, tensile tests can be conducted on a wide range of materials, comprising metals, polymers, composites, and ceramics.
  • The data obtained from tensile testing support in the development of new materials with improved mechanical properties.

Consequently, tensile test machines have become indispensable tools for researchers, engineers, and producers in various industries.

Understanding Tensile Strength: Manufacturers and Testing Methods

Tensile strength is a crucial indicator for manufacturers across numerous industries. This attribute quantifies a material's resistance to elongation before it fails. To accurately evaluate tensile strength, manufacturers rely on standardized analysis methods.

A common method involves subjecting a test piece to a controlled load until it yields. The maximum pressure the material can withstand before yielding is then recorded as its tensile strength.

Results are often expressed in units of pounds per square inch (psi), providing a measurable representation of the material's strength.

Manufacturers utilize this analysis to select appropriate materials for specific applications. For example, a bridge requires materials with high tensile strength to bear immense forces, while a flexible toy might prioritize flexibility.
